50 CFR 80.38: May a State fish and wildlife agency certify a license when an entity other than the agency offers a discount on a license or offers a free license?

A State fish and wildlife agency may certify a license when an entity other than the agency offers a license that costs less than the regulated price only if:

(a) The license is issued to the individual according to the requirements at § 80.33;

(b) The amount received by the agency meets all other requirements in this subpart; and

(c) The license meets any other conditions required by the agency.
